I had one my dad gave me about 20 years ago. I somehow managed to break the handle a few years back but I kept the head. Was cleaning out the garage the other day and found it and started a restoration.

I ground and polished the metal, bought a new handle, sanded it down to a 600-grit finish, burnt in some texture on the bottom of the handle to improve the grip and then burn the end to add some character. After that I soaked the whole thing in linseed oil overnight. Went ahead and gave it to Mack today. He definitely scored off my Corona virus boredom.
